If you haven't followed Boundless very closely (me neither), it's time to play catch-up, because it's launching to PC and PS4 this September. Lots of MMO-style gaming across a huge, single-shard universe of procedurally-created worlds, with a user-based economy and prim-based-creation. So much ambition threatens to disappoint, but the development studio is Wonderstruck, founded by veterans of EA and legendary Lionhead Studios, so I'm inclined to give them a chance.
The humanoid, alien avatars are an interesting choice and may turn off would-be players seeking ultra-realistic humans, but my bet is this is a smart choice, going after the market that made Minecraft and Roblox so popular, and are seeking the next evolution in games like those.
